Alert: QueuePilot broker upgrade (v6 to v7) scheduled for the Westhollow cluster this Thursday night. Security-relevant bits: the new version drops TLS 1.1, rotates inter-node certs automatically, and changes the default auth plugin — so old service accounts will fail closed, which is intentional. We'll run both versions side by side for an hour. If anything in the cert handling looks off to you, flag it to the platform crew.

escalation mailbox, yajeg-bageg: quenax.olidor@lumiccorp.internal

# Squatwatch scanner configuration.
# This service checks the internal Drelfield registry mirror for packages
# whose names sit within edit-distance 2 of our published libraries.
# SCAN_INTERVAL_MIN controls polling frequency; default 30.
# QUARANTINE=true moves flagged packages to the review bucket automatically.
# False positives go to the triage queue, not straight to blocklists.
# The scanner authenticates to the registry mirror using the credential set on the next line.

vault entry, kafog-yahop: COURIER_KEY8=0faa53ae

### v3.2.0 — Renamed setting

Keyspindle no longer reads `KS_ROTATE_TOKEN`; it was renamed for consistency with the plugin API. Plugins targeting 3.2+ must use the new name or rotation hooks will not fire. The old name is ignored silently — no deprecation warning is emitted. Update your `.env` before upgrading. Keep `KS_PLUGIN_DIR` and `KS_LOG_LEVEL` as-is. Immediately after those entries, add the renamed token line with your existing value.

secret setting of kawif-kajef: COURIER_KEY3=d2b